SSIFF presents Psarokokalo (Greek Centre)

About
A series of award winning short fiilms from the Athens Short Film Festival, Psarokokalo, two of which are finalists in our festival.
Kappa
Dark Comedy, Greece 15:04
Dir. Damianos Chrysochoidis
In the fake world of stardom, actor 'Kappa' portrays a loving person and father figure when he plays the starring role in a lighthearted TV sit-com and when he presents himself in the media. His fake identity is juxtaposed with his true self: an egomaniac who constantly neglects his family and is possessed by sexual and perverse desires.
Clementine
Drama, Greece 13:16
Dir.George Stagakis
In a provincial town, 18-year-old Clementine works at the farmer’s market with her oppressive father, until a coach from Athens discovers her talent in football.
Miss Dress
LGBTQ+ Greece, 9:47
Dir. Panos Boras
In the universe of Miss Dress, the exhibition to the public is a moment of revelation. The wounded child's soul, continuing in the adult body, seeks acceptance and love.
Boo!
Romance, Greece, 18:17
Dir. Georgia Michailidi
Sunshine and Lilian are two ghosts in love, looking for a new Host to haunt so they can stay on earth together. Time is running out and Sunshine will have to leave her trauma behind in order to live her afterlife.
A 10 Minute Swim,
Drama, Greece, 24:07
Dir. Achilles Tsoutsis
In 70's Albania, two lovers will go up against the dictatorship to be together.
Memories of Occupation - Pyrgi
Greece, 9:30
Dir. Dimitris Argyriou
The Greek village, Pyrgi, was looted, massacred and burned completely by German troops. This is its story.
